Is it hard to get 700 on GMAT?

A 700 on the GMAT is an accomplishment that only 1 out of 8 test-takers achieves, so the journey probably won't be easy. But it's also not mysterious: a 700 is the product of lots of hard work and a little strategic thinking. How many hours GMAT daily?

We suggest that you study for at least 1.5 hours per weekday and 4+ hours on weekend days (assuming you have a traditional work-week schedule). You should also pay attention to your personal needs.

How many hours is 700 GMAT?

On an average, students who score above 700 study 100+ hours in a span of three months. However, since our hypothetical base score is 120 points less than our goal score of 700+, this test taker should have a GMAT study plan of at least 130 hours.

Is 700 good GMAT score?

The GMAT top score of 800 puts you in the 99 percentile category, meaning that you've scored higher than 99% of all candidates. According to most MBA experts, a score above 700 is considered great, while anything over 650 is good.

How many people get 700 on GMAT?

A 700 GMAT is the 88th percentile according to the Graduate Management Admission Council (GMAC). In other words, just 12% of every test taken or roughly 1 in every 10 ultimately yield a score of 700 or above. In real numbers, just 32,500 of the 259,884 GMAT tests taken beat 700.19 Aug 2019

Can I crack GMAT in 3 months?

According to experts and mentors on GMAT preparation, it takes 3-5 months of concerted study schedule to crack GMAT with high score. If you can enjoy the preparation journey, scoring high in GMAT may not be difficult.2 May 2015

How many months are enough for GMAT?

Remember, studying for the GMAT takes time. Plan to spend about two to three months and 100–120 hours reviewing material and practicing regularly. The top scorers on the GMAT spend 120+ hours, on average, studying for Test Day over a period of time.9 Nov 2021

Is 2 months enough for GMAT?

A 60-day GMAT study plan is not too short: two months gives you enough time to both study and breathe a little, so it prevents the over-stressing caused by high-intensity 30-day study plans. It's also not too long: you won't have enough time to start forgetting the material you learned at the beginning of your studies.
